The strong demand has continued since then as CEO Torsten M\u00fcller-\u00d6tv\u00f6s says the order intake has exceeded the company\u2019s expectations. In a phone call with journalists this month, the head honcho said RR might have to adjust production should the trend continue in the future.<\/p>\n<p>The Goodwood-based company will commence production of its very first EV in a few months, so it still has time to decide whether a higher production output is necessary to meet strong demand. The first deliveries to customers will be made in the final quarter of 2023. It\u2019s the company\u2019s second-most expensive car, after the $460,000 Phantom flagship with which it shares the platform. Lest we forget the company set a new all-time record last year by delivering more than 6,000 vehicles for the first time. Sales rose by 8% compared to the year before, reaching 6,021 units. As a reminder, <a href=\"https:\/\/www.bmwblog.com\/2022\/02\/02\/rolls-royce-all-electric-2030\/\">Rolls-Royce has pledged to sell only electric cars from 2030<\/a>. MINI will follow suit early next decade while BMW isn\u2019t planning to discontinue ICE-powered cars anytime soon.
